PPMs or PH. Assuming both? Mix your Grow Big And Tiger bloom at 1/4 strength and check the PPMs. If your run off was 800 and you want a 1000, your nutrient mix should be 1200 PPMS. This 1200 averaged with the 800 gets you the 1000. Seeing as you’re a little out of PH range, I would feed at 6.8-6.9. Test the run off on this. Soil PH and stabilization can also be achieved by top dressing some dolomite lime but it’ll take some time. The best future advice I can offer is to switch to coco and Jacks 321. With coco it’s feed daily and always the same proportions except seedling stage

Nice job on cutting your tap water, with a TDS that high you’re probably safe with calcium and magnesium. I would continue to monitor the run off PPMS and PH. Keep using the Grow Big and Tiger bloom. Both have your nitrogen, potassium and phosphorus that’s needed particularly the Tiger bloom for the flowering stage and the needed nitrogen. Personally I would mix a gallon at 1/4 for the Grow Big and 1/2 strength on the Tiger bloom and check the PPMs and shoot for 1100 plus your tap. Knowing how high your water source TDS is I think you’ll be safe at around 1400 PPMS
